CI note: Tumblebox locker access flow

The locker-open integration test fails when the staging badge service returns stale grants. Clear the grant cache fixture before each run; the setup script now does this automatically. If you still see access-denied errors, rerun with verbose auth logging enabled and attach the output, quoting the build token below.

pipeline stamp: htk9_ce63042d9

## Formula sandbox tuning

User-supplied formulas in Gridmoor execute inside a restricted interpreter with hard ceilings on time, memory, and call depth. Reviewers should confirm any change to these ceilings is justified in the PR description, since raising them widens the abuse surface. Defaults were chosen from production traces. The current limits are as follows.

limits module of tafog-fawip:
WEIGHTS = {
    "julix": 57,
    "lamys": 992,
    "kasvan": 209,
    "quenok": 750,
    "alddor": 259,
    "oliath": 1009,
    "wenix": 815,
}

### Action Item: Webhook Retry Hardening

Following the Parcelwing outage, webhook deliveries to plugin endpoints retried too aggressively, amplifying load on already-degraded receivers. We are moving to exponential backoff with jitter and a hard delivery ceiling. Plugin authors should ensure their endpoints return proper status codes, since retries now key off them strictly. The retry schedule and ceilings are governed by the following constants, which take effect next release.

tuning table, faduf-baduf:
PRIORITIES = {
    "ulavan": 191,
    "silys": 750,
    "goriel": 238,
    "kelmir": 66,
    "wendor": 432,
}